- Dallas Semiconductor’s digital temperature sensor DS1820 supports temperature sensing of the “first-line bus” interface
- Machine. The unique and economical characteristics of the first-line bus make it easy for users to form sensor networks and introduce a new concept for the construction of measurement systems.
- Now, the new generation of “DS18B20” is smaller, more economical, and more flexible. This allows you to give full play to the strengths of the “first-line bus.”

- characteristics
- • Unique single-line interface requires only one port pin for communication
- • Simple multi-point distribution application
- • No need for external devices
- Electricity available through data lines
- • Zero standby power consumption
- • Temperature range -55 ~ +125 °C, increasing at 0.5 °C. Fahrenheit Devices-67 ~ +2570F, increasing by 0.90 F
- • Temperature read in 9-digit quantities
- • Temperature digital quantity conversion time 200ms(typical value)
- Non-volatile temperature alarm settings that users can define
- Alarm Search Command identifies and marks devices that exceed the programmed temperature limit(temperature warning conditions)
- Applications include temperature control, industrial systems, consumer products, thermometers, or any thermal sensing systems.
